net: mdio: realtek-rtl9300: enhance documentation & naming
The Realtek ethernet MDIO driver currently only serves SOCs from the
Realtek RTL930x series. This is only one lineup of the Realtek Otto
switch series that also knows RTL838x, RTL839x, RTL931x devices.
All of these share similar hardware with comparable MMIO access logic
but have individual variations. Important to note
- Controller works on switch ports instead of buses and addresses.
- Devices incorporate additional MDIO hardware. E.g.
- an auxiliary MDIO controller for GPIO expanders [1]
- a MDIO style SerDes controller [2]
To avoid future confusion enhance the driver documentation and
function naming. Make clear what this driver is about and what
parts are generic and what parts are device specific. For this
rename the function and structure prefix as follows:
- for generic functions use otto_emdio_
- for device specific helpers use e.g. otto_emdio_9300_
This prefix naming tries to align with the watchdog timer [3].
It paves the way so that drivers for the other Realtek Otto MDIO
controllers can be added in future commits using the same naming
convention.
Remark 1: The read/write functions are kept device specific for now
because they will only fit the RTL930x SOCs. Renaming will take place
as soon as the I/O handling will be generalized.
Remark 2: The driver name "mdio-rtl9300" is kept for now.
